U of M professors say Hamline admin compromised academic freedom
The University of Minnesota’s art history department says it is taking an unusual step of making public its criticisms of another school’s actions involving a professor. Hamline’s president has said the school does respect academic freedom, but not at the expense of students.
'Cannot learn while we are leaking': Bill seeks free period products at school
Minnesota lawmakers are trying once again to require school districts to provide free menstrual products to students. At a recent hearing students testified about why easy access is important.
Federal judge rules Mille Lacs County illegally restricted tribe's policing powers on reservation
The ruling is the latest victory for the Mille Lacs Band of Ojibwe in its ongoing dispute with the county over the boundaries of its central Minnesota reservation, and what powers the tribe has within those boundaries.
Deteriorating ice conditions force some Minnesota winter events to pivot
Heavier-than-average snowfall across much of Minnesota this winter has been a boon to a lot of winter sports enthusiasts. But it’s now causing problems with ice conditions on some frozen lakes, forcing organizers of some events to change plans.
'A huge concern': December storm did long-term damage to state's forests
The winter storm that smacked much of the state just before Christmas cut off power to thousands of homes, but also left long-lasting damage to the state’s forests. It’s damage that won’t be fully documented until the snow melts.
Publishers concerned as slow U.S. mail delays delivery of local newspapers
A growing number of local newspapers have switched from using carriers to the U.S. Postal Service for delivery, a cost-cutting move as print subscriptions decline. But getting those papers into the hands of readers while the news is still timely has been a challenge.
